Remedies Available When Operating Agreements Are Violated
When an LLC operating agreement is violated, several remedies may be available to address the breach and enforce the agreement’s provisions. The appropriate remedy depends on the nature and severity of the violation. Common legal remedies include injunctions, damages, and specific performance. Injunctive relief may be sought to prevent ongoing or future breaches that could harm the LLC or its members. Damages serve as compensation for losses resulting from the breach, aiming to restore the injured party to the position they would have been in without the violation. Specific performance compels the breaching party to fulfill their contractual obligations when monetary damages are insufficient.
In addition, courts may impose equitable remedies such as rescission or reformation of the operating agreement to correct ambiguities or unfair terms. When disputes arise, members can also opt for internal resolution methods like arbitration or mediation, which may lead to settlement agreements or enforcement orders. Ultimately, the choice of remedy is influenced by the specific circumstances and the enforceability of the operating agreement provisions, emphasizing the importance of clarity and enforceability in the document.

Enforcing Operating Agreements in International or Multi-State LLCs
Enforcing operating agreements in international or multi-state LLCs presents unique legal challenges due to jurisdictional complexity. Different states or countries may have varying laws governing LLCs, which can impact enforceability.
To navigate these complexities, LLC members should include clear arbitration clauses and choice of law provisions in their operating agreements. This ensures disputes are addressed within a predetermined legal framework, simplifying enforcement efforts.
When disputes arise, enforcement may involve multiple jurisdictions, requiring familiarity with local laws and international treaties. Key steps include filing in the appropriate jurisdiction and understanding applicable procedural requirements.
Typical enforcement strategies include:
- Seeking judicial recognition in relevant jurisdictions.
- Utilizing international arbitration if specified.
- Coordinating legal proceedings across jurisdictions to uphold the agreement.
By proactively addressing jurisdictional issues in the operating agreement, LLCs can better safeguard enforcement of their provisions across borders.
